
Heating pads are a popular and widely used remedy for muscle pain and stiffness, offering a non-invasive and convenient way to alleviate discomfort. By applying gentle heat to the affected area, heating pads can help relax tense muscles, improve blood circulation, and reduce inflammation, making them particularly beneficial for individuals suffering from muscle soreness, cramps, or chronic conditions like arthritis. The warmth from the pad encourages muscle fibers to loosen, enhancing flexibility and providing temporary relief from pain. However, it’s essential to use heating pads correctly, as prolonged or excessive heat can lead to skin irritation or burns. When used appropriately, heating pads can be an effective and soothing tool for muscle recovery and comfort.

Heat Therapy Benefits
Heat therapy, often administered through heating pads, is a time-tested method for alleviating muscle pain and stiffness. By increasing blood flow to the targeted area, heat relaxes tense muscles and enhances flexibility. This is particularly beneficial for chronic conditions like arthritis or acute injuries such as strains. For optimal results, apply a heating pad set to a moderate temperature (104–113°F or 40–45°C) for 15–20 minutes, repeating as needed. Avoid prolonged use to prevent skin irritation or burns, especially in individuals with diabetes or circulatory issues.
Consider the mechanism: heat therapy works by dilating blood vessels, which improves oxygen and nutrient delivery to muscles. This process accelerates healing and reduces inflammation. For athletes or active individuals, using a heating pad pre-workout can enhance performance by loosening muscles, while post-workout application aids in recovery. Pair heat therapy with gentle stretching for maximum benefit, but avoid applying heat to acute injuries within the first 48 hours, as it may exacerbate swelling.
From a practical standpoint, heating pads are versatile and accessible. They come in electric, microwaveable, or chemical-activated varieties, catering to different needs. For localized pain, such as a sore neck or lower back, use a smaller pad to target the area effectively. For widespread discomfort, larger pads or wraps can provide uniform relief. Always place a cloth barrier between the pad and skin to prevent direct contact, and never fall asleep with a heating pad on to avoid overheating.
Comparatively, heat therapy stands out as a non-invasive, drug-free alternative to pain management. Unlike medications, it carries minimal side effects when used correctly. Studies show that consistent heat application can reduce muscle soreness by up to 30% in adults over 18. However, it’s not suitable for everyone—pregnant women, individuals with heart conditions, or those with open wounds should consult a healthcare provider before use. When applied thoughtfully, heat therapy is a powerful tool for muscle recovery and comfort.

Pain Relief Mechanisms
Heat therapy, when applied through a heating pad, triggers a cascade of physiological responses that alleviate muscle pain. The primary mechanism involves vasodilation, where blood vessels expand, increasing blood flow to the targeted area. This heightened circulation delivers oxygen and nutrients to the muscles, accelerating the removal of waste products like lactic acid that accumulate during physical activity. For instance, a 20-minute session with a heating pad set at 104–113°F (40–45°C) can effectively enhance blood flow, reducing stiffness and soreness. However, it’s crucial to avoid temperatures above 113°F to prevent tissue damage, especially in individuals with sensitive skin or conditions like diabetes.
Another pain relief mechanism is the alteration of nerve signal transmission. Heat stimulates thermoreceptors in the skin, which then send signals to the brain that interfere with pain perception. This process, known as the "gate control theory," effectively reduces the intensity of pain signals reaching the brain. For acute muscle injuries, applying a heating pad for 15–20 minutes every 2–3 hours can provide significant relief. Conversely, chronic muscle pain may benefit from longer, less frequent sessions, such as 30 minutes once or twice daily. Always ensure the heating pad has an automatic shut-off feature to prevent overheating.
Heat therapy also promotes muscle relaxation by reducing the viscosity of synovial fluid in joints and improving muscle flexibility. This is particularly beneficial for conditions like muscle spasms or tightness. For example, athletes often use heating pads pre-workout to warm up muscles, reducing the risk of injury. Post-workout, heat can soothe overworked muscles, enhancing recovery. A practical tip is to combine heat therapy with gentle stretching to maximize benefits. However, avoid applying heat immediately after an acute injury (within the first 48 hours), as it can exacerbate inflammation.
Lastly, heat therapy has a psychological component that contributes to pain relief. The soothing warmth from a heating pad can induce relaxation, reducing stress and tension, which often amplify pain perception. For individuals with chronic muscle pain, incorporating heat therapy into a nightly routine can improve sleep quality, further aiding recovery. Pairing heat application with deep breathing exercises or meditation can enhance its calming effects. Always monitor skin for redness or discomfort, and never use a heating pad on open wounds or areas with reduced sensation.
In summary, heating pads offer multifaceted pain relief by improving circulation, modulating nerve signals, enhancing muscle flexibility, and promoting relaxation. By understanding these mechanisms and applying heat therapy correctly, individuals can effectively manage muscle pain while minimizing risks.

Muscle Recovery Speed
Heating pads can significantly accelerate muscle recovery speed by enhancing blood flow to affected areas. When muscles are strained or fatigued, increased circulation delivers essential nutrients and oxygen, which are critical for tissue repair. Applying a heating pad at a moderate temperature (104°F to 113°F) for 15–20 minutes post-activity dilates blood vessels, reducing stiffness and soreness. This method is particularly effective for delayed onset muscle soreness (DOMS), typically experienced 24–72 hours after intense exercise. For optimal results, use the pad during this window, but avoid immediate post-injury application, as heat can exacerbate inflammation in the first 48 hours.
Contrast therapy, alternating between heat and cold, further optimizes recovery speed. Start with a heating pad for 20 minutes to relax muscles and improve flexibility, followed by an ice pack for 10 minutes to reduce inflammation. Repeat this cycle 2–3 times, ending with cold. This technique is backed by studies showing it enhances muscle repair and reduces recovery time by up to 25%. Athletes aged 18–40, especially those in high-intensity sports, benefit most from this approach. Caution: Individuals with cardiovascular conditions or diabetes should consult a healthcare provider before using heat therapy.
Incorporating heat therapy into a structured recovery routine yields measurable improvements in muscle recovery speed. For instance, a 2021 study published in the *Journal of Athletic Training* found that participants using heating pads post-exercise regained 90% of their baseline muscle function within 48 hours, compared to 72 hours in the control group. To maximize benefits, pair heat application with light stretching or foam rolling. Avoid overheating by using pads with auto-shutoff features and never apply directly to skin—always use a barrier like a towel. Consistency is key; integrate this practice into your post-workout regimen for sustained results.
While heating pads are effective, their impact on recovery speed varies by individual factors such as age, fitness level, and injury severity. Older adults (50+) may experience slower recovery due to reduced blood flow, making heat therapy particularly beneficial for this demographic. However, prolonged use (>30 minutes) can lead to skin irritation or burns, so monitor application time closely. For acute injuries, prioritize cold therapy initially, transitioning to heat after 48 hours. Combining heat with proper hydration, adequate sleep, and balanced nutrition amplifies its efficacy, ensuring muscles recover faster and more efficiently.

Safe Usage Guidelines
Heating pads can alleviate muscle pain and stiffness, but their benefits hinge on proper use. Misapplication risks burns, tissue damage, or exacerbated inflammation. To maximize safety and efficacy, follow these guidelines tailored to different scenarios and user profiles.
Application Duration and Frequency
Limit sessions to 15–20 minutes at a time, allowing skin to cool between uses. Prolonged exposure, even at low heat, can impair circulation and cause discomfort. For chronic conditions, space treatments 2–3 hours apart, avoiding cumulative overheating. Athletes or those with acute injuries should consult a physical therapist for personalized timing, as overuse may delay healing by increasing inflammation.
Temperature Settings and Monitoring
Start on the lowest setting, gradually increasing heat only if necessary. Medium settings (104–113°F) are generally safe for adults, but sensitive individuals or elderly users should remain below 100°F. Always place a cloth barrier between the pad and skin to prevent direct contact burns. For children over 12 or individuals with diabetes/neuropathy, caregiver supervision is critical due to reduced heat sensitivity.
Placement and Mobility Considerations
Avoid using heating pads on areas with diminished sensation (e.g., post-surgery sites) or over inflamed joints. Secure the pad with elastic bands or wraps only loosely to prevent pressure sores. Never sleep with an active heating pad; opt for timed models that auto-shutoff after 30–60 minutes. For mobile use, battery-operated pads with overheat protection are safer than corded versions, reducing tripping hazards.
Contraindications and Special Populations
Pregnant individuals should avoid abdominal application, focusing instead on lower back or limbs. People with cardiovascular conditions must limit sessions to 10 minutes to avoid fluid shifts. Those on blood thinners or with bleeding disorders risk bruising from vasodilation, so consult a physician before use. Infants and pets are strictly prohibited from direct or indirect exposure due to their inability to communicate discomfort.
Post-Use Care and Maintenance
Inspect pads for frayed cords or uneven heating before each use; discard damaged units immediately. Clean fabric covers with mild detergent after every session to prevent bacterial growth. Store pads flat to avoid wire damage, and unplug them when not in active use. Pair heat therapy with hydration to support muscle recovery, as warmth increases fluid loss through perspiration.

Alternatives to Heating Pads
Heating pads are a popular remedy for muscle soreness, but they’re not the only option. For those seeking variety or alternatives due to sensitivity, accessibility, or preference, several effective methods exist. Each alternative offers unique benefits, catering to different needs and situations.
Active Recovery: Movement as Medicine
Gentle movement can alleviate muscle tension by increasing blood flow and reducing stiffness. Low-impact activities like walking, swimming, or yoga are ideal. For instance, a 20-minute walk or a 15-minute yoga session can ease soreness without overexertion. Avoid strenuous exercise, as it may exacerbate pain. This method is particularly beneficial for individuals over 18, as it combines pain relief with cardiovascular health.
Topical Treatments: Targeted Relief
Creams and gels containing menthol, arnica, or capsaicin provide localized relief by numbing pain or increasing circulation. Apply a pea-sized amount to the affected area, massaging gently until absorbed. Repeat every 4–6 hours as needed. Caution: Test on a small area first to avoid skin irritation. These products are suitable for adults and teens but should be used sparingly on sensitive skin.
Cold Therapy: The Anti-Inflammatory Approach
While heating pads relax muscles, ice packs reduce inflammation and numb pain. Apply an ice pack wrapped in a cloth for 15–20 minutes every 1–2 hours during the first 48 hours of injury. This method is especially effective for acute injuries or post-workout soreness. Avoid prolonged use, as excessive cold can cause tissue damage.
Foam Rolling: Self-Myofascial Release
Foam rolling targets muscle knots and improves flexibility. Spend 1–2 minutes on each muscle group, applying moderate pressure. For example, roll your calves, quads, and back against a foam roller. This technique is accessible for all ages but should be avoided on injured or inflamed areas. Pair it with deep breathing for enhanced relaxation.
Hydration and Nutrition: Internal Healing
Dehydration and nutrient deficiencies can worsen muscle soreness. Drink 8–10 glasses of water daily and incorporate magnesium-rich foods like spinach or almonds, which aid muscle function. For acute relief, consider an Epsom salt bath (1–2 cups per bath) to absorb magnesium transdermally. This holistic approach complements external treatments and supports long-term muscle health.
By exploring these alternatives, individuals can find tailored solutions to muscle discomfort, ensuring relief without relying solely on heating pads.
